KATA ROCKS Celebrity Interior Designer Appointed

Category: Real estate, Posted:26 Dec 2009 | 06:00 am

In the latest installment of the south's Almost Famous ocean front condo project Kata Rocks as added in celebrity interior designer Kelly Hoppen to the team, with leading architect Adrian McCarroll from Original Vision and Discovery Channel's Man vs. Wild star Edward Bear Grylls purchasing a premium penthouse.
Based in the UK's Notting Hill (same place but not the movie) she has worked with leading personalities Jude Law, Elton John and David Beckham. In addition Kelly is the author of the book “East Meets West: Global Design for Contemporary Interiors”.
Its good to see a growing emphasis not only on leading architects coming to Phuket but now the all important interior designers which will up the ante with perhaps more cohesive execution then was seen in the developing years of old.
